Baker Elementary is a Title I public elementary school that is part of the Henrico County Public Schools school district, located in Richmond, VA with about 392 students offering grade levels from Pre-Kindergarten to 5th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 21 teachers, George F. Baker Elementary has a student/teacher ratio of about 18: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.

School Demographics for 392 students
The primary ethnicity of students attending GEORGE F. BAKER ELEMENTARY SCHOOL is predominantly Black or African American, representing about 91% of the student body.
- Black or African American
- 90.6%
- Hispanic/Latino
- 3.6%
- Two or more races
- 2.8%
- White
- 2.6%
- American Indian or Alaska Native
- 0.3%
-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islander
- 0.3%
- Female
- 45.9%
- Male
- 54.1%
